I believe she still has the overall highest winrate on PC.

I saw somebody explain that somewhere else, I think on Reddit: Symmetra is a character you switch away from in the course of the match, and usually never switch TO. Most Symmetra players, myself included, will usually pick someone else when the game isn't going our way, and the enemy is pushing too hard too fast. And since the game counts the last character you're playing as as the one who "lost," then that's why Symmetra's win rate is probably artifically high.
